Attendant definition

Attendant means the person in charge of the operation of a boiler or unfired pressure vessel.
Attendant means any person who obtains admission to an outdoor assembly by the payment of money or by the rendering of services in lieu of the payment of money for admission.
Attendant means an individual stationed outside one or more permit spaces who monitors the authorized entrants and who performs all attendant's duties assigned in the employer's permit space program.

More Definitions of Attendant

Attendant means a trained and qualified individual responsible for the operation of an ambulance and the care of the patients, regardless of whether the attendant also serves as driver.
Attendant means a person whose presence is essential to the Registered User to enable the Registered User to physically use the service and whose origin and destination are the same as the Registered User;
Attendant means the person having control of an animal/pet visiting or in residence in a facility.
Attendant means a person trained to operate a pool, including slides and other appurtenances, and control patrons in a safe and orderly manner.
Attendant means an employee of the municipality or agent of the municipality duly authorised to be in charge of the disposal site;
Attendant means a certified or licensed person qualified to assist in the provision of emergency medical care.
Attendant means any person capable of providing rescue who is responsible to the management.
